"Daisy" My 1950 3100

I'd like you guys to see my project girl. I bought her 3 years ago as a complete truck. It had a 235 and 4 speed behind it. With a last known registration of 94' I brought her home changed the points poured gas in the carb and bam! She was running. Once I knew it was safe after doing all the brakes, and a few other engine issues sorted I drove her locally for 2 years.
About a year ago my father in law and I pulled the factory drive train and I slowly started my build.

Here is the parts list and the photos.
Some are before it was torn down and it will look similar only lowered more.

327 V8
S-10 T5
Speedway Drop Axle
Dana 44 rear
3" lowering leafs
C-10 Power steering
Disc brake conversion up front
Factory Location 7" Brake booster
15x8 Steelies
Coker Classic white walls









































And that's where it sits now. We should be running brake lines the week. I'll be painting under the cab this week as well and hopefully setting in on the frame by Friday. I still need to source my bed wood and then it will be final assembly. Once it's assembled I'll be doing the interior. Rust prevention, paint, and sound deadening. Carpet and seat covering after that. Hopefully it will be on the round next month sometime. Thanks for looking!
